Best Free Financial Modeling & Analysis Courses

Find the best online Free Financial Modeling & Analysis Courses for you. The courses are sorted based on popularity and user ratings. We do not allow paid placements in any of our rankings.

Introduction to Financial Modeling

Learn to build a simple integrated financial statement model.

Created by Peter Lynch - VP in Private Equity


Students: 114840, Price: Free

This course will teach you how to use two years of historical income statement data and two years of historical balance sheet data to build a fully integrated financial statement model. It is designed for those new to financial models.

Section 1 will introduce the accounting equation and the three primary financial statements in the context of building a financial model. The content starts with the accounting equation, which is the single most important concept in accounting. The remaining three videos introduce the financial statements one at a time with a focus on the relationships that are important as you build financial models.

All of the material is provided via video-driven instruction with notes in pdf format to help follow along.

Section 2 will walk through integrating the three primary financial statements and creating a five-year projection. The first video provides a quick overview of the process. It is an easier process to grasp if thought of as a series of steps. It will also make it easier to measure progress as you work through the longer video. The video in Lecture 2 will walk you through the process of building the model cell by cell.

Because you are walking through the entire process of building a model, the video in Lecture 2 runs long: 35 minutes total. My advice would be to download the excel template attached to this lecture and build the model as the video progresses. Building the model yourself is the best way to fully understand the process.

In my opinion, if you want to build a strong financial modeling skill set, a thorough understanding of how an integrated financial statement model works is one of the most important things you can learn.

The last video in this section will explain circular references and how to fix broken models. It can be incredibly frustrating to finish a model and realize that it does not "balance." This video will help avoid that frustration.

I hope the content is useful to you! Please feel free to email me ( with any feedback.

Note: The longer video has some white noise in the background that I am having edited out. I hope to have a cleaner audio file up soon. Thanks for your patience!

Build a DCF Model from Scratch

Learn to build a DCF Model.

Created by Peter Lynch - VP in Private Equity


Students: 15035, Price: Free

This course will walk you through two Discounted Cash Flow ("DCF") models to properly introduce all relevant concepts. The first DCF model will use everyday context to make the process easy to understand. The video runs less than 10 minutes long, and uses a simple example to introduce the purpose of DCF analysis.

Once the "Basic Discounted Cash Flow Model" has been introduced, the material will explain two concepts separately: Net Present Value ("NPV") and Weighted Average Cost of Capital ("WACC").

The last video walks through a more thorough discounted cash flow ("DCF") model. In this video we will use an integrated financial statement model to perform a DCF analysis of a company.

All videos are recorded in HD. Please click on the HD button at the bottom of the screen when watching the material.

Each lecture has an Excel template or PDF notes available for download.

Practical Oriented Analysis of Financial Statements

A beginners course for practical oriented reading of financial statements.

Created by Syed Naser Mohiuddin - Manager


Students: 11681, Price: Free

This course is meant for beginners and it attempts to explain how a line item in financial statements correlates with overall health of a business. It is meant for those who are interested in understanding the significance (rather than definition) of each element of financial statements and interested in fitting them together to get the overall picture.

Interpreting financial statements

Achieve proficiency in interpreting the financial statements of a company. Learn how to prepare financial ratios.

Created by Gabriel Dragne - Finance Expert


Students: 10244, Price: Free

This new course starts from the grounds of financial statements and show how they are obtained in the first place. Then it expands on the three main financial statements: balance sheet, income statement and cash flows, by showing their advantages and disadvantages, what they tell and what they hide from the viewer, how they differ from each other and how they are linked. We will focus a lot on the cash implications of financial statements, and by the end of this course we will be able to use cash flows to evaluate the health of a company and we will be able to understand, prepare and analyze “most wanted” financial ratios. Moreover, we will grasp what you need to know on adjacent subjects like weighted average cost of capital, valuation methods, mergers and acquisitions, currency translation and others. Every topic is presented from an industry best practice perspective and is accompanied by a final quiz to test your progress. Besides using small study cases that illustrate particular areas, we will be accompanied throughout the course by a four year period financial data of a study company, for which we will recreate and interpret together the cash flow statements and ratios for three years. It shall be optional, however advisable, that you will continue our endeavor and derive the cash flows statement and ratios, together with their interpretation, for the last year of the analysis. No worries, I will provide permanent assistance should you need additional help to finalize the homework.

If you’re a finance student, an entrepreneur or a finance professional willing to expand on financial statements knowledge, this course if for you, as you will find a lot of new or untold information, perfectly structured and covering all hot topics. If you’re rather new to finance matters, this course if perfect to build a solid knowledge, however you should be at least familiarized with the finance jargon. However, even if you did not experienced financial statements before, the course content does not leave you with missing pieces for the financial statements puzzle. Basic mathematical skills are a prerequisite and you will also need access to a computer with installed Microsoft Excel and basic Excel skills to finalize the analysis.

This course consists of videos lectures and shall require more than three hours of your time, with estimations for the homework analysis to account for another three hours.

I am assured that after taking this course, you will be confident in analyzing financial statements and be able anytime to prepare and interpret the cash flow statement and the financial status for any given company.

Let’s get started!

Intro to Quantitative Financial Modeling in Excel

Learn how to build financial models in Excel and VBA for different financial topics

Created by FM x FM - Subject Matter Expert in Financial Modeling


Students: 4464, Price: Free

Excel is an excellent tool for understanding the intricacies involved in financial modeling. The aim in each section of the course is to explain the implementation of the models using Excel.

Some models discussed in this course:

  • Black-Scholes-Merton (BSM) Option Pricing Model

  • Binomial Option Pricing Model

  • Portfolio Optimization

  • Option Implied Volatility

  • Value-at-Risk (VaR) and Conditional Value-at-Risk (CVar): Historical, Gaussian and Cornish-Fisher (NEW! Added on 4th June 2020)

  • Optimization of VaR and Trading Liquidity Risk: Unwinding a Position Optimally (NEW! Added on 4th June 2020)

To benefit from this course, it is advised that you try building the models as you go through the videos.

As I am nearing to the 2 hour limit for a free course, I will no longer be adding new videos to this course. If I want to add more videos, then I will have to convert it to a paid-course, which I am not planning to do anytime soon.

Financial modeling (DCF and LBO) – basic version

Prepare for investment banking interviews - learn / improve skills

Created by CorpFin Pro - Practicing corporate finance professionals


Students: 4448, Price: Free

In this course, we prepare a basic financial model consisting of:

  1. Three statements (Balance Sheet, Income Statement and Cash Flow Statement),

  2. DCF (using the FCFF approach), and

  3. LBO.

This course might be useful for people preparing for interviews at investment banks, consulting firms, buy-side firms, etc. Also, this course might be useful for people interested to learn new things and in general interested in finance.

Financial Modelling Basics – Mini Course

The Ultimate Financial Modelling Mini Course

Created by Piyush Arora, CFA, MBA Finance - Champ at 'All Things Finance'


Students: 4068, Price: Free

This FREE mini course helps the student understand the basics of financial modelling including:

1. The ground rules (setting formatting rules)

2. How to start building financial models

3. How to make assumptions for revenue

4. How to make assumptions for direct costs

5. How to make assumptions for indirect costs

This course will also prepare the students for any advanced level courses in Financial Modelling.

How 8 Financial Ratios Can Allow You to Analyse Any Business

How to use ratios to conduct a deeper financial analysis

Created by Nakhoul Mohamed - Administrateur Public


Students: 4000, Price: Free

For any individual wishing to discover finance, at some point he will be led to know or learn the financial analysis,no matter the reason, being a banker or business owner to an investor managing his stock portfolio and aiming to buy the most profitable stocks, perhaps inspired by the greatest Warrant Buffet.

I have to ask the question, Is a lack of accounting training holding you back from getting value from these important financial documents?

The financial statements, these being the Income Statement, Balance Sheet & Cash Flow Statement, allow you to tell the ‘story’ of a business. You can tell its history, its strengths and weaknesses and sometimes even its future. Financial numbers alone will not tell you everything about a business.

The statements tell a concise story that can be used by investors and managers to test and assess strategy, as well as assist in putting together action plans in regards to whether or not to buy, hold or sell a stock or what to do internally within the business. But being able to look behind the numbers and gleam this story takes some skill.

However, not lots of skill! Accountants, like many professions, like to make their skills seem more complicated than what they really are; after all, this allows them to charge higher fees.

But ANY business manager, investor or student can quickly learn some key techniques that will allow them to tell the story of almost any business on the planet.

Accountants have the ability to turn vast amounts of data into actionable information, but they tend to give their own names to this ‘actionable information’ and in effect create a language of their own. And if this is all foreign to you: firstly, congratulations on taking the first steps, you won’t regret it. Secondly, in this courseI will try to clearly, simply and concisely break down this ‘foreign language’ and its arithmetic tools into something more digestible, irrespective of whether you’re a marketer, barista, production manager or even a retiree managing their nest egg.

this course has several objectives, all in the way of giving the learner an arsenal of tools allowing him to conduct a complete financial analysis, with effectiveness and above all efficiency.

efficiency is the key to success, being efficient means being able to reach the goal in the minimum amount of time with the minimum of used resources , here are the ratios.

the ratios which by their simplicity make it possible to manipulate the financial analysis and to create a model of analysis that suits the user according to his objective.

If you are looking to identify the company with the most profitable stocks in terms of dividends, you only have to mobilize these small tools called ratios in a certain way and here is in a moment you identify the most profitable stocks.

again if you want to know if your business is solvent, you only have to use the ratios again and you will have the information you want.

Technical Analysis Stock Trading

Professional Forex Trading, Technical Analysis, Learn How to Trade Forex with Candlestick Patterns &Trendline

Created by Ali pouyanmehr - money manager


Students: 3976, Price: Free

regardless which specific methodology is preferred, trend line and trend channel analysis is one of the foundation elements of technical trading approaches that every single trader simply has got to understand and master. our course provides this instruction, and is the only product of its kind available at. simply put, you will not find a more compelling treatment of this subject anywhere.

In this course you will learn everything you need to know to start Trading the Forex Market right now!

This is not just a theoretical course, there is LIVE Example Included (where we show you how to use the information learned to Trade Live in Real Time).

You will be learning from Mohsen Hassan, who is the Founder of Boom Trading.

So whether you want to generate some side income by trading the FOREX Market or if you want to make trading your only source of income (like our Traders), then this course is for you.

In This course we will cover beginner and Intermediary level information to get you on the right path to becoming a successful and a consistently profitable Trader. On top of all the material thought we will be giving you our personal tricks, techniques and views on the Forex market that have tremendously fast-tracked our success.

By the end of this course you will understand the History of Money and understand the Structure of the FOREX Market.

You will know how to analyze the Currency you are trading by learning Technical Analysis and Fundamental Analysis. You will learn how to use the Economic Calendar to avoid or play fundamental events that can impact wildly Currency prices.

You will also become an expert in Chart reading! This means you will know how to spot the best Chart Patterns and Candlestick Patterns as well as use the best Technical Indicators in order to buy and sell at optimal locations.

We also cover Risk Management and Money Management techniques so you will be able to know exactly how much to buy or sell on each trade and where to place your take profits and stop losses to minimize your risk!

Going further than other trading courses we even cover Trading Psychology. Something that we have noticed has a huge impact on trading performance!

When registering to this course, you have:

  • Lifetime Access to the course

  • Access to all new/additional lectures (My courses are always up to date!)

Eager to see you in the course!

Who this course is for:

  • Beginners who want to decrease their learning curve by learning from a Trading Firm CEO.

  • Traders who are starting out and Intermediary level Traders who are not yet consistently profitable.

  • Anyone who wants to Day-Trade or Swing-Trade the FOREX Market.

  • Anyone who wants to learn the most important concepts that are needed to become successful in trading.

Show less

Introduction to Excel for Finance and Accounting

Learn how professionals use Excel in the fields of Finance and Accounting by completing FOUR mini-projects

Created by Dobromir Dikov - FCCA, FMVA


Students: 2986, Price: Free

If you are about to enter a role anywhere between accounting and finance, there’s a high chance you’ll probably face the challenge of preparing various Excel files. It would be great if you have an idea of how we use Excel in the fields of finance and accounting.

And this is the course to introduce to the main concepts of Excel that are applicable to these fields!

You will start with the main Excel functions, go over the most important shortcuts, and build four mini-projects that accountants and financial analysts prepare in their daily job!

What you’ll get out of this course?

Introduction to Excel for Finance and Accounting course will guide you through the most common functions and shortcuts used by people in the fields of accounting and finance and show you the practical process of creating working files in Excel, step by step. We will define a clear structure and build four mini-projects, which you can reuse over and over again. I will help you understand the main principles that finance and accounting professionals use in their daily work.

I will show you some ways to tremendously improve your productivity by employing shortcuts and standardizing your workflow.

After you take the Introduction to Excel for Finance and Accounting course, you will have a solid understanding of how Excel formulas and principles are applied within the fields of Finance and Accounting.

What should you know to take the course?

It is possible to follow along and learn a lot from the course, even without basic accounting and Excel knowledge, as I will go over the concepts and provide thorough explanations.

Who is this course for?

I made the Introduction to Excel for Finance and Accounting course to serve as a practical guide on how the concepts are applied in the field. The course is most suitable for:

· Junior finance and accounting professionals;

· Business owners and entrepreneurs who want to know more about their figures;

· Students in Finance and Accounting majors who wish to get a head start.

I hope you are ready to upgrade yourself, learn how Excel formulas and principles are used in Finance and Accounting and propel in your career!

Are you excited to start?

Then enroll in the course, and I’ll see you in class!

Financial Modelling for Mining Companies – Masterclass

Build and analyze mining financial models for project finance, corporate finance, or private equity.

Created by Perry Fisher - Corporate Trainer | Consultant | The Tauro Group


Students: 2577, Price: Free

Financial modelling is the most important tool in a company’s decision-making arsenal. This course is specifically designed to provide dealmakers, analysts and other financing professionals with the tools they would require in order to analyze any mining financial model, and prepare powerful summarization outputs upon which decisions would be made.

The "Financial Modelling for Mining Companies - Masterclass" course is the first part of the more comprehensive "Financial Modelling for Mining Companies - Novice to Expert" course. It is ideal for fast-tracking industry professionals in their career path - teaching them to analyze existing client models and also create their own models for various applications. The material is well suited to middle-office and front-office professionals, teaching them to assess the risks of funding mining opportunities. This masterclass can be enrolled in for free, before delving into the deeper “Novice to Expert”.

By the end of the course you will be able to effectively construct a financial model that describes the process flow of your mining business, from raw material extraction, all the way until net profit after tax. You will learn how to itemize all cost and revenue drivers, model tax, working capital, and debt funding.

The concepts taught are based on years of investment banking experience, and billions of dollars worth of project financing deals in multiple jurisdictions.

Students would need to download the ABC Mining Financial Model (provided for free) in order to participate in the course.

I look forward to engaging with you as the course progresses!

Perry Fisher

Simple Algorithmic Trading Crash Course

Learn how to snag the most in demand role in the tech field today!

Created by Mammoth Interactive - Top-Rated Instructor, 800,000+ Students


Students: 1108, Price: Free

Algorithmic Trading with Python, Statistics and Pandas – one of the most interesting and complete courses we have created so far. It took our team slightly over four months to create this course, but now, it is ready and waiting for you.

An exciting journey from Beginner to Pro.

If you are a complete beginner and you know nothing about coding, don’t worry! We start from the very basics. The first part of the course is ideal for beginners and people who want to brush up on their Python skills. And then, once we have covered the basics, we will be ready to tackle financial calculations and portfolio optimization tasks.

Finance Fundamentals.

And it gets even better! The Finance block of this course will teach you in-demand real-world skills employers are looking for. To be a high-paid programmer, you will have to specialize in a particular area of interest. In this course, we will focus on Finance, covering many tools and techniques used by finance professionals daily.

This course is great, even if you are an experienced programmer, as we will teach you a great deal about the finance theory and mechanics you will need if you start working in a finance context.

Everything we teach is explained in the best way possible. Plain and clear English, relevant examples and time-efficient videos. Don’t forget to check some of our sample videos to see how easy they are to understand.

Understanding of Flow through

Flow through for various situation of business

Created by Ganesh Mathur - Finance professional


Students: 448, Price: Free

Its important for any business owner, finance professional or manager to understand the flow through and how it is calculated for various situations. Knowing it well will give the edge to a person who can better manage his business as the key points impacting the flow-through of 'conversion of profit' is explained in this lecture.

Principles of Economy and Econometric Modelling

Basics of Economy, Economic Challenges, GDP Forecast, Fiscal Deficit, Investment Strategy

Created by Vipin Mittal - IIT, MBA ( SPJIMT) 23 yrs Diversified Experience


Students: 372, Price: Free

The course would enable you to develop a simplified understanding about Economics as a subject. After completing the course you would be able to understand the various basic economic principles, players, drivers of the Indian Economy.

You would be able to learn about the various approach to determining the GDP and significance of each of the GDP components.

You would be able to understand the various challenges faced by the Indian Economy and what measures each of the players are taking to overcome them.

You would learn the basics of econometric modelling

You would understand the scenario planning and generate the various GDP fall scenarios

You would be able to learn the forecasting of the GDP contractions and govt Fiscal deficit forecast.

At the end of the course one would become smart enough to interpret the Govt policies and actions when it comes to controlling the economy

One would learn the interrelationship of Interest rate, inflation rate and Money supply and how these variables interact with each other to drive the economy and what are the limitations for govt to influence each of these variables.

One would be in a position to use predict the movement of the interest rate and determine their investment strategy for maximising the return.

FTE – Full Time Equivalent, a productivity measure

FTE analysis reveals if the manpower is used at optimum level and to ascertain productivity levels.

Created by Ganesh Mathur - Finance professional


Students: 358, Price: Free

We have explained the method of calculating Full time equivalent popularly known as FTE. How it is different from Head count in any Business Unit and how to calculate Productivity ratio and use it in practical environment.

This course explains the link between FTE and Productivity. Anyone after completing this course can start using FTE and Productivity model in their businesses and take the benefit.